What Color Of Sunglasses Is Best?

Sunglasses are more than just a fashion accessory; they are a crucial tool for protecting your eyes from harmful UV radiation and reducing glare. When it comes to choosing the right pair of sunglasses, the color of the lenses plays a significant role in determining their functionality. In this article, we'll explore the various lens colors available and help you determine which one is best suited for your needs.

Understanding Lens Colors:

Gray Lenses:

Gray lenses are the most popular choice because they offer true color perception. They reduce brightness and provide excellent protection against glare without altering the colors you see. Gray lenses are ideal for all-purpose use, including driving, outdoor activities, and everyday wear.
Brown Lenses:

Brown lenses enhance contrast and depth perception, making them an excellent choice for outdoor sports like golf, cycling, and fishing. They are also suitable for driving in various light conditions.
Green Lenses:

Green lenses provide good contrast and reduce glare. They are particularly effective in low-light conditions and are often chosen by golfers and baseball players for their ability to enhance ball visibility.
Amber and Yellow Lenses:

Amber and yellow lenses enhance contrast and are perfect for low-light conditions such as dawn or dusk. They are often used for activities like hunting, skiing, and shooting.
Rose and Pink Lenses:

Rose and pink lenses are known for their ability to enhance depth perception and provide good contrast in low-light settings. They are popular among cyclists, runners, and those participating in winter sports.
Blue Lenses:

Blue lenses are more of a fashion statement than a functional choice. They don't provide much benefit in terms of glare reduction or UV protection.
Choosing the Right Lens Color:

Consider Your Activities:

Think about the primary activities you'll be engaging in while wearing your sunglasses. Different lens colors are better suited to various activities and lighting conditions.
Eye Color and Sensitivity:

Your eye color can influence how certain lens colors affect your vision. Light-colored eyes may be more sensitive to bright light, while dark eyes may be more tolerant.
Personal Preference:

Ultimately, your choice of lens color should also reflect your personal style and comfort. If you feel good in a particular color, you're more likely to wear your sunglasses consistently.
UV Protection:

Regardless of the lens color, ensure your sunglasses offer 100% UV protection. This is crucial for safeguarding your eyes from harmful ultraviolet rays.
Conclusion:

The best color of sunglasses for you depends on your lifestyle, activities, and personal preferences. Gray lenses are versatile and suitable for most situations, while other colors like brown, green, amber, and yellow offer specific advantages for various outdoor activities. Remember that UV protection is paramount, so always choose sunglasses that block 100% of UV rays. Ultimately, the perfect pair of sunglasses is the one that not only protects your eyes but also suits your unique style and needs.

How to Wear Cat Eye Glasses?

Since the cat eye frame glasses are so popular, you may ask whether I can wear the cat eye glasses. Usually, cat eye glasses can suit a variety of face shapes. But faces with more angular or prominent features would look best in a round or oval shaped pair of cat eye glasses because these cat eye frame glasses will balance wide jawlines of square or triangle faces, while the rounded lens will soften sharp features.

However, the round face will look best in frames which are with bold and angular lines. These striking details will help to sharpen soft facial features and rounded jawlines. You can click here to know more knowledge of the face shape and how to choose the glasses frames.

Pure titanium

When the titanium purity reached more than 99% of the titanium metal materials, they can be called pure titanium glasses. Many people may not know what pure titanium is. In reality, many famous brand glasses are made of this material. The frames made of pure titanium have the benefits of high melting point, light material, strong resistance to corrosion, and strong electroplating, to ensure the two important properties of beauty and durability spectacle frames.

Drivers can wear night-vision goggles

Night-vision goggles can prevent headlights from blinding, add color saturation, and make the field of vision clearer. The normal night vision glasses are golden yellow in color and have a metal coating on the surface. This is the use of diamond high perspective reflection film technology, in the lens to add color and film layer, in order to maximize the brightness of the object being seen. It is to compensate for the light for driving, which makes light pass through your eye. It can increase the three-dimensional sense of objects, making the line of sight more clear, to avoid confusion caused by blinding headlights.

What does vision insurance cover?

Vision insurance and vision benefit plans usually cover the cost of annual eye exams, prescription glasses, and/or contact lenses. Vision insurance includes traditional health/medical policies and health/discount plans that provide vision benefits and cover most. Coverage will vary depending on the type of vision insurance or vision benefit plan you choose. Group vision insurance is usually provided through an employer, an organization, or a government plan like Medicare or Medicaid. If you don't qualify for any of these options, you can purchase a personal vision care plan from a vision insurance provider.
